The story of Beatrice Mary Walker began in 1859 in Saint Thomas, Elgin, Ontario, Canada. Beatrice Mary Walker married Herbert Harrie Schreiber, and had children including Beatrice Mary Schreiber, Edith Caroline Rose Schreiber, Enid May Schreiber, Norman De Lisle Schreiber, Weymouth Brock Collingwood Schreiber. Beatrice Mary Walker passed away in 1897 in Erindale, York, Ontario, Canada.
